Fig. 5: SIMO reconstructed spatial multi-omics organization of mouse cerebral cortex.
From: Spatial integration of multi-omics single-cell data with SIMO

a Spatial integration results of mouse cerebral cortex data. Spots and cells are colored according to different categories. b, c The box plot shows the distance between the main cell groups in the single-cell transcriptome data (b) and single-cell DNA methylation data (c) after spatial mapping and the innermost C6 group in the ST data. Different cell types are included, with varying sample sizes for each cell type (n = 50 for Layer2/3, n = 351 for Layer5a, n = 120 for Layer5, n = 265 for Layer5b, n = 454 for Layer6, n = 237 for mL2/3, n = 92 for mL4, n = 94 for mL5-2, n = 50 for mL6-1 and n = 333 for mL6-2). In the box plots, the range of each box extends from the first to the third quartile, with the horizontal line representing the median. The whiskers extend to 1.5 times the interquartile range beyond the lower and upper bounds of the box. Source data are provided as a Source Data file. d, e SIMO mappings of Layer5a cells, with cells color-coded based on DNA methylation cell types (d) and RNA clusters (e).
